The South Iredell Vikings didn't have quite enough to beat the Northern Guilford Nighthawks on Tuesday and fell 2-1. South Iredell have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
South Iredell's loss dropped their record down to 2-3. As for Northern Guilford, their win bumped their record up to an identical 2-3.
Both teams are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. South Iredell will challenge Northwest Cabarrus at 6:30 p.m. on Thursday. As for Northern Guilford, they will take on Northwest Guilford at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day. Northern Guilford's defense better be ready for this one: Northwest Guilford have averaged an impressive 2.7 goals per game this season.
